Docker修改MySQL默认端口
默认看到这的会拉镜像用Docker启动MySQL
1.启动mysql
docker启动MySQL命令
docker run -p 4422:4422 --name mysql \
-v /mydata/mysql/log:/var/log/mysql \
-v /mydata/mysql/data:/var/lib/mysql \
-v /mydata/mysql/conf:/etc/mysql \
-e MYSQL_ROOT_PASSWORD=root \
-d mysql:5.7
2.修改配置文件
linux 挂载配置文件地址 /mydata/mysql/conf
在这个路径下 修改my.cnf
配置文件
[client]
default-character-set=utf8
[mysql]
default-character-set=utf8
[mysqld]
port=4422
init_connect='SET collation_connection = utf8_unicode_ci'
init_connect='SET NAMES utf8'
character-set-server=utf8
collation-server=utf8_unicode_ci
skip-character-set-client-handshake
skip-name-resolve
主要是把端口设置成你要改的。
3.重启mysql
保存配置文件,重启mysql
docker restart mysql
4. 登陆mysql,查看端口
登录MySQL查看端口号
docker exec -it mysql mysql -uroot -prootshow global variables like 'port';
大功告成,打完收工!
Docker修改MySQL默认端口相关推荐
- linux 修改mysql默认端口3306
linux 修改mysql默认端口3306 cd /etc/mysql/my.cnf 修改两处 客户端的port=3306 和mysqld的服务器端口port=3306 [client] port=3 ...
- 记录docker修改mysql映射端口
刚学习docker 记录以下修改docker mysql容器映射端口号 一.问题描述 1.在创建mysql容器时指定映射端口号,后期需要修改映射端口 二.操作步骤 1.先停掉docker容器,执行以下 ...
- 修改Mysql默认端口的方法
1. 登录mysql [root@test /]# mysql -u root -p Enter password: 2. 使用命令show global variables like 'port'; ...
- centos下修改mysql默认端口_CentOS下修改Apache默认端口80
nyoj325 zb的生日(DFS) zb的生日 时间限制:3000 ms | 内存限制:65535 KB 难度:2 描述 今天是阴历七月初五,acm队员zb的生日.zb正在和C小加.neve ...
- centos7 安装Apache、PHP、MariaDB并修改相关默认端口
一.安装前准备开放端口 需要配置服务器端口,天翼云80端口默认关闭,这里使用8080端口作为web访问端口,62323端口作为数据库MySQL的端口. 关闭firewall: systemctl st ...
- Docker 修改MySQL表大小写敏感
最近遇到一个问题,项目在Windows里运行正常,但在Linux里运行时就报错,提示好多表不存在,经过排查发现MySQL数据库中表名是大写的,然后报错信息里表名是小写的,于是我大胆的推测可能是Linu ...
- Linux 修改SSH 默认端口 22,防止被破解密码
2019独角兽企业重金招聘Python工程师标准>>> Linux/Unix 系统,很多人使用SSH + 密码来登陆服务器,默认 22端口,这样会有被暴力破解密码的危险(除非密码足够 ...
- linux怎么修改sftp默认端口,如何在 Linux 系统中如何更改 SFTP 端口
SFTP(SSH文件传输协议)是一种安全文件协议,用于通过加密连接在两个主机之间传输文件. 它还允许您对远程文件执行各种文件操作并恢复文件传输. SFTP可以替代旧版FTP协议. 它具有FTP的所有功 ...
- Linux下使用MySQL——忘记root密码及修改MySQL默认编码
概述: 本博客不再对MySQL的语法进行讲解和说明,想了解或熟悉的朋友请自行百度或Google学习.本博客主要是针对MySQL除语法之外的总结,希望能够也能帮助到你. 1.CentOS6.x下MySQ ...
- MySQL如何修改表的储存方式_修改mysql默认存储引擎的方法
修改mysql默认存储引擎的方法,供大家学习参考. 先来了解一下mysql存储引擎: mysql服务器采用了模块化风格,各部分之间保持相对独立,尤其体现在存储架构上.存储引擎负责管理数据存储,以及my ...
最新文章
- Linux环境编译安装Mysql以及补装innodb引擎方法
- 第五课-第三讲05_03_bash脚本编程之二 条件判断
- JavaScript中的原型,对split方法的重写
- Qt Linguist手册
- python升级matplotlib包_Python-matplotlib包
- Navigation execution entry point
- python 反复访问迭代器iter,反复使用next
- 为什么大公司都不用mfc和qt_百度竞价推广效果下降,为什么有的老板还是只愿意做百度推广?...
- Axure添加官方元件库
- 【JSP内置对象】之9大内置对象(JavaWeb必背必掌握)
- 俄罗斯独立自主的计算机技术和计算机网络
- 非线性控制1.0——自适应控制和鲁棒控制
- PCB个性logo设计
- 颜色偏差裙子测试软件,蓝黑/白金裙子告诉你视觉误差到底有多大?——一条裙子引发的全民纠结...
- RootKit分析:主页保安推广病毒+独狼2 排查与分析全过程
- 从红包场景谈事务一致性
- Systemverilog:面向对象编程与面向过程编程区别
- HTML中label标签的用途
- 虚幻引擎图文笔记:蓝图中二项切换节点(Flip Flop)的用法
- Android电池功耗BatteryHistorian数据分析
热门文章
- Delphi10.4.1开发Linux应用视频重播
- HTML5期末大作业:餐饮甜品网站设计——美食蛋糕店(48页) HTML+CSS+JavaScript 学生DW网页设计作业成品 web前端开发技术 web课程设计 网页规划与设计
- HashKey TokenGazer | 去中心化身份(DID)研究报告
- 百度的71个炸天的开源项目
- phpstorm设置鼠标滚动缩放代码字体大小
- linux上运行java程序 jar格式
- wine QQ安装笔记
- ISO/IEC 27002:2022中文版
- android 高通替换开机logo,高通平台 开机logo 替换
- QT5软件开发入门到项目实战PDF(配完整示例代码)(持续更新)